Biography of The Rock: A Glimpse Into His Early Life
Before he became the global phenomenon we know today, Dwayne Johnson was just a kid growing up in a wrestling family. Born on May 2, 1972, in Hayward, California, The Rock's journey began under the watchful eyes of his parents, who were both involved in professional wrestling.
His father, Rocky Johnson, was a legendary wrestler in his own right, while his mother, Ata Johnson, came from the famous wrestling dynasty, The Maivia Family. This background laid the foundation for Dwayne's future in the wrestling world, though he initially pursued football before finding his true calling.
Let's take a quick look at some key facts about The Rock's early life:
Key Facts About The Rock's Background
- Full Name: Dwayne Douglas Johnson
- Date of Birth: May 2, 1972
- Place of Birth: Hayward, California
- Parents: Rocky Johnson (father) and Ata Johnson (mother)
- Family Heritage: Descendant of the Maivia wrestling dynasty

The Rock's Wrestling Journey: From Ring to Stardom
Now that we've covered his birth, let's talk about how The Rock's early years shaped his wrestling career. After a brief stint in football, Dwayne Johnson entered the wrestling world, where he quickly made a name for himself as one of the most electrifying performers of all time.
His wrestling persona, The Rock, became a cultural phenomenon, known for his catchphrases, charisma, and unmatched talent in the ring. But it wasn't all smooth sailing. The Rock faced numerous challenges and setbacks, which only fueled his determination to succeed.
Key Moments in The Rock's Wrestling Career
- 1996: Debuted in the WWF (now WWE) as Rocky Maivia
- 1998: Adopted the name "The Rock"
- 2001: Won the WWE Championship for the first time
- 2004: Retired from wrestling to pursue acting
These moments laid the groundwork for his transition into Hollywood, where he would go on to become one of the highest-paid actors in the world.
Transition to Hollywood: The Rock's Acting Career
So, what happened after The Rock hung up his wrestling boots? He transitioned seamlessly into acting, starring in blockbuster films that cemented his status as a global superstar. But how did he make the leap from wrestling to Hollywood?
It all started with a few key roles that showcased his versatility and charm. Movies like "The Scorpion King" and "The Mummy Returns" introduced him to a wider audience, proving that The Rock was more than just a wrestler—he was a legitimate actor.
Notable Films in The Rock's Career
- The Scorpion King (2002): His breakout role
- Fast & Furious Franchise: Solidified his action star status
- Jumanji Franchise: Showcased his comedic talent
With each role, The Rock continued to expand his repertoire, proving that he could handle anything Hollywood threw his way.
